Promise Inclusion offers a wide range of activities and services for adults with learning disabilities and/or autism in the Wokingham and Bracknell Forest Boroughs. Our goal is to help every individual have fun, learn new skills, make friends, and build confidence in a supportive community environment.
What we offer:
- @ The Acorn: A social group for people aged 18+ (including those with complex needs) held at a local community venue in Wokingham.
- Bracknell Social Group: Weekly social group for adults with learning disabilities and/or autism at various venues in Bracknell Forest.
- Paul’s Karaoke: Fun karaoke sessions for people aged 16+ with a learning disability and/or autism, funded by donations.
- Gateway Award: A life skills programme for individuals aged 18+ with mild to moderate learning disabilities and/or autism, with no upper age limit.
All our activities are designed to help participants:
- Socialise and make new friends
- Become more independent
- Build self-esteem and confidence
- Learn and improve skills
Support for Families and Carers: We also offer a range of activities and support for families and carers, including respite activities, peer support, and practical help from our Family Liaison Team.
Who can join? Adults (16 or 18+, depending on the activity) with a learning disability and/or autism living in Wokingham or Bracknell Forest Boroughs. Some activities are open to those with complex needs.
